TiO₂ Price Forecast: Weak Demand Persists, but Further Declines May Be Limited (2026-07-24 to 2026-07-31)

China TiO₂ Price Forecast: Weak Demand Persists, but Further Declines May Be Limited

Buyer Summary: The China TiO₂ Market remained weak after a leading manufacturer reduced its listed prices and several other producers followed with adjustments of approximately USD 44–73/ton. Poor downstream demand, growing inventories, and intense competition continued to affect transactions, but high sulfur and sulfuric acid costs may limit the scope for further broad reductions. Buyers are likely to continue receiving differentiated, case-by-case quotations.

1. Titanium Dioxide (TiO₂) Market Analysis

  • After a leading titanium dioxide manufacturer lowered its listed prices, several other producers followed with reductions of approximately USD 44–73/ton, adding further pressure to the domestic market.
  • Downstream demand and purchasing activity remained weak, while shipments were generally slow. Inventories continued to rise at some plants, prompting producers to control output and contributing to a decline in TiO₂ production during July.
  • Competition in the chloride-process market remained intense, with prices also moving lower. The price gap between sulfate-process and chloride-process TiO₂ narrowed, increasing market differentiation.
  • Although suppliers remained under inventory and shipment pressure, high production costs limited their ability to make substantial further reductions. Most transactions continued to be negotiated individually.

2. Titanium Dioxide Pigment Market Trends

  • Domestic ilmenite prices continued to soften as reduced TiO₂ production lowered raw material demand. Current prices are approximately USD 179–186/ton for Panzhihua 46% ilmenite and USD 203–211/ton for Panzhihua 47% ilmenite.
  • Imported ilmenite quotations remained around USD 220–230/ton CIF for Mozambique material, USD 200–215/ton FOB for Vietnam B-grade material, and USD 220–240/ton CIF for Australian material, although market quotations remained highly differentiated.
  • Sulfuric acid prices weakened in selected regions but remained relatively high. Current prices are approximately USD 231–243/ton for 98% smelting acid delivered in Yunnan and USD 254–269/ton delivered in Hubei.
  • High sulfur prices continued to support sulfuric acid production costs. Two TiO₂ plants recently completed conversions from sulfur-based acid to smelting acid production in an effort to manage raw material expenses.
  • Although lower ilmenite and smelting acid prices provided some cost relief, sulfate-process producers remained under significant cost pressure, limiting the room for further substantial TiO₂ price adjustments.

3. Market Forecast

  • The near-term TiO₂ Price Forecast remains weak as slow purchasing activity, rising inventories, and strong supplier competition continue to weigh on market sentiment.
  • Selective quotation adjustments may continue among producers facing greater shipment and inventory pressure. However, high sulfuric acid costs and compressed margins are likely to restrict the scale of further reductions.
  • Reduced July production may gradually ease part of the supply pressure, but the effect could remain limited until downstream restocking demand shows a meaningful recovery.
  • Competition between sulfate-process and chloride-process TiO₂ is expected to remain intense, and quotations may continue to vary significantly by production route, inventory level, and supplier cost structure.
  • For buyers, the current market may provide favorable negotiation opportunities, but procurement decisions should also consider supplier production status, delivery reliability, and the risk of frequent quotation changes.
